In a world where mothers are often seen primarily as caregivers, one Texas-based photographer is challenging that perception by highlighting the strength and capabilities of working moms. Jessica Lane, a military mom turned photographer, is dedicated to shining a spotlight on mothers in uniform through her latest initiative.
Lane’s project, titled the “Uniformed Breastfeeding Portrait Collection,” features powerful images of breastfeeding women dressed in their professional attire. Recently, she shared a breathtaking photograph of a woman in a police uniform nursing her child, which quickly gained traction online. In her post, Lane expressed that she had envisioned this moment for quite some time, noting that the image showcases a mother who embodies both dedication to her profession and nurturing spirit.
Her mission goes beyond individual portraits; Lane aims to represent as many women as possible from various career fields, demonstrating that the role of a mother is multifaceted. “This portrait represents the strength of working mothers,” she explains, “especially those who serve their communities in demanding jobs.”
When Lane asked her followers for the first word that came to mind upon seeing the photograph, responses ranged from “courageous” to “inspiring.” One commenter remarked, “This woman embodies service, putting her life at risk for those she doesn’t know while simultaneously caring for her family. That is the true essence of a servant’s heart.”
This isn’t Lane’s first viral moment; she previously captured a group of ten active-duty military moms breastfeeding in their uniforms, an image that was shared extensively. This response motivated her to expand her project to include mothers from various professions, including healthcare workers and first responders. “I want to show that working mothers can balance their careers and breastfeeding,” she notes. “These portraits reinforce that idea.”
